Ingredients

Scale
  • 45 lb beef shoulder roast
  • 2 tablespoons neutral oil
  • 2 cups fresh apple cider
  • 2 cups chicken stock
  • 2 tablespoons Dijon mustard
  • 1 tablespoon dehydrated minced onion
  • 1 head garlic, top sliced off
  • 3 rosemary sprigs
  • 4 thyme sprigs
  • 1 red onion, cut into thick slices
  • 2 firm apples, peeled and cut into wedges
  • kosher salt
  • freshly cracked black pepper

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 325°F.
  2. Trim excess fat from the beef shoulder roast, pat dry, and season generously with salt and pepper.
  3. Heat neutral oil in a large Dutch oven over medium-high heat; sear beef until browned on all sides.
  4. In a bowl, whisk together apple cider, chicken stock, Dijon mustard, and dehydrated minced onion.
  5. Pour the braising liquid over the seared beef, then add rosemary, thyme (tied together), and the garlic head. Cover tightly and transfer to the oven.
  6. Braise for about three hours, flipping halfway through. Add sliced red onion and apple wedges during the last 30–45 minutes of cooking.
  7. Allow the beef to rest in its juices for 30 minutes before serving.
